SNL legend returns to show after 10 years for digs at DOGE, Trump’s Zelenskyy meeting
- Shane Gillis returned to SNL after a year away, having been originally hired and then fired, and hosted the show while playing a low-energy version of himself in various sketches.
- Musical guest Tate McRae performed two songs and appeared in a video while a tribute card for David Johansen, frontman of New York Dolls, was shown during the show.
- The cold open featured a humorous take on the Oval Office meeting between President Trump and President Zelensky, with criticisms of Zelensky's attire.
- Despite some funny moments, critics found the overall episode crude, with backlash for Gillis's controversial jokes.
